Top 5 Puzzle RPG Apps Performance in Costa Rica: Q1 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 Puzzle RPG apps on a unified platform in Costa Rica during the first quarter of 2025, with ins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2025, Costa Rica's Puzzle RPG app market saw varied performance across the top five applications on a unified platform. Here’s a detailed look at their trends:
Cup Heroes from Voodoo had a notable fluctuation in weekly revenue, starting at $139 and peaking at $275 in mid-March. Downloads showed growth, particularly in February with a jump to 3K. Active users rose to over 9K in February before settling at around 7.9K by the end of March.
DRAGON BALL Z DOKKAN BATTLE by Bandai Namco Entertainment Inc. experienced significant weekly revenue spikes, notably reaching $1.8K in early February. Downloads hit a high of 2K in mid-February, with active users peaking at 2.7K in the same period.
Slugterra: Slug it Out 2 from Nightmarket Games Inc. maintained stable weekly revenue, averaging close to $100. Downloads remained steady, peaking at 431 in February. Active users increased consistently, reaching 1.1K by early March.
Backpack Hero: Merge Weapons by Zego Global Pte Ltd showed no revenue, but downloads were initially strong at 843 in early January, tapering off to around 128 by the end of March. Active users mirrored this trend, starting high and decreasing to 154.
Empires & Puzzles: Match 3 RPG from Small Giant Games had a robust revenue performance, peaking at $1.4K in February. Downloads were modest, but active users increased to 503 in early March.
